Output 7e58ac3f70866a76c75f28b193616667af885ef529890f82d16d21ab152c048e:0

value
980012162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d72723e098b562731ddc66b19dbbef3531e315d OP_EQUAL
address
38kX4BQPtxqFFysHnoMaMxsRVB18Ey1PeP
transaction
7e58ac3f70866a76c75f28b193616667af885ef529890f82d16d21ab152c048e
spent
true